Comments: |
Our state tree, the cabbage
palm is the most carefree palm in our area. It is also a
valuable wildlife plant and highly tolerant of the worst
urban conditions. The most hurricane-proof of any tree
in our region. Just plant, water and forget about it. Do
not remove green fronds from this plant when pruning. |
